With a crucial World Cup qualifier against Nigeria’s Super Eagles on the horizon, the Rwanda Football Federation has appointed a new head coach for the Amavubi.

The Rwandan national team had been without a head coach since the departure of German tactician Thorsten Spittler.

However, the Rwanda Football Association (RFA) has now confirmed the appointment of Algerian coach Adel Amrouche to lead the squad.

Amrouche’s first test will come against the Super Eagles at the Amahoro Stadium in Kigali.

Rwanda currently leads the group with seven points, while Nigeria sits second from bottom with four points.
